Lassa Fever (LF) remains a health burden in several endemic areas of Nigeria, and its toll remains unabated over several decades. Although most studies have focused on virological and clinical considerations, few studies have attempted to address the perceived psychosocial component of LF disease in Nigeria. Evaluation of stigmatization and discrimination faced by LF survivors is an important step in improving individual health and protecting public health. This study aimed to assess LF-associated stigmatization associated among staff and students of the University of Benin. Descriptive analyses of 600 consenting respondents (300 staff and 300 students) sampled using pretested questionnaires was conducted, and the Chi-square test was used to test for significant association between perceived LF stigmatization and predefined variables. LF was a potential cause of stigmatization in a higher proportion of student (n = 162, 57.9%) than staff (n = 112, 39.9%). LF-associated stigmatization among students was significantly associated with sex (p = 0.012) and poor knowledge (p = 0.013) of LF transmission and prevention. A greater tendency for stigmatization was observed among females than males. A comprehensive emergency response plan incorporating accurate knowledge dissemination about the disease may be a first step toward tackling perceived LF stigmatization.

This study is conducted to assess the quality of harvested rainwater. Rooftop rainwater samples are collected between April and September 2015 from Ugbihioko village near Benin City, Nigeria. Heavy metal concentration and physicochemical quality are determined with the use of standard analytical techniques for water quality, and the results are compared to the World Health Organization (WHO) acceptable limits for drinking water. Of the different water quality parameters, the results show that temperature is within WHO drinking water standards for all locations, but pH, turbidity, sulfate, chloride, and nitrate concentrations vary considerably and do not meet the standards for all locations. Regarding the maximum acceptable concentration (MAC), electrical conductivity is well below the MAC for all cases; the heavy metals copper and iron are above the MAC for all cases; the light metals sodium and potassium are below the MAC for all cases. Lead is above the MAC for all locations, except for in one location; and selenium varied, with some sites having selenium concentrations above the MAC. The results from this study show that public health education or advising is vital for mitigating the possible risks that can be linked to the use of harvested rainwater without treatment.

This study evaluated the kinetic signature of toxicity of four heavy metals known to cause severe health and environmental issues--cadmium (Cd), mercury (Hg) lead (Pb) arsenic (As)--and the mixture of all four metals (Mix) on MCF7 cancer cells, in the presence and absence of the antioxidant glutathione (GSH). The study was carried out using real time cell electronic sensing (RT-CES). RT-CES monitors in real time the electrical impedance changes at the electrode/culture medium interface due to the number of adhered cells, which is used as an index of cell viability. Cells were seeded for 24 h before exposure to the metals and their mixtures. The results showed that in the presence and absence of cellular glutathione, arsenic was the most cytotoxic of all five treatments, inducing cell death after 5 h of exposure. Lead was the least cytotoxic in both scenarios. In the presence of cellular GSH, the cytotoxic trend was As > Cd > MIX > Hg > Pb, while in the absence of GSH, the cytotoxic trend was As > Hg > MIX > Cd > Pb. The findings from this study indicate the significance of glutathione-mediated toxicity of the metals examined--particularly for mercury--and may be clinically relevant for disorders such as autism spectrum disorder where decreased glutathione-based detoxification capacity is associated with increased mercury intoxication.
